SCARLETT 

His eyes darted to mine, fear flickering in them like a dying candle. My pulse hammered against my ribs. This was it. This was the moment I would find out the truth. My father’s fate depended on his next words.

"Speak now," I said, my voice barely above a whisper but filled with fire. "Were you the one who framed my dad?"

Zayden's lips parted, but for a second, nothing came out. Then he shook his head, his brows knitting together. "How could you even think that, Scarlett? Your father and I built that company from the ground up. We were best friends! There’s no way I’d frame him for something like that."

I scoffed. "And yet, you’re the CEO now that he’s gone. Convenient, isn’t it?" My hands curled into fists at my sides, nails biting into my palm. "You keep saying you’re doing everything to help him, but where is the progress? Why is he still rotting in that prison?"

His gaze darkened. "I’m trying, Scarlett. You have to believe me."

"Believe you?" A bitter laugh bubbled up my throat. "How can I believe you when every sign points to you? My dad was accused of embezzling money from the company—the same company you both worked so hard to build. And now he’s gone, and you’re in charge. What do you expect me to believe?"

He took a step forward, his hand reaching out. "Scarlett—"

I jerked back. "Don’t. Don’t touch me."

His face twisted with something I couldn't quite name. Regret? Desperation? Guilt?

"Why are you doing this?" he whispered. "Last night—"

"Last night was a mistake," I cut in, my voice sharp. "And for your information, I don’t have feelings for you anymore. You disgust me. You have no morals, no conscience. You wanted to have something with me while I was married to your son. What kind of man does that? What do you gain from this?"

His expression hardened. "You think I planned for this to happen? You think I wanted to feel this way about you? I fought it, Scarlett. I fought it with everything I had. But you…"

I shook my head, my chest tightening. "Don’t. Just stop. You’re evil. You’ve ruined my life."

His hands curled into fists, his whole body tense. "I didn’t ruin your life. I was trying to do what was best for you. If I had married you, people would have talked."

"Do you think I care?" I snapped, anger flaring hot inside me. "You made me marry Vincent instead. Do you think that was the better option?"

Silence stretched between us, thick and suffocating.

"From now on," I said, my voice cold, "whenever you see me in this house, move to the left. Stay out of my way. I never want to be near you again."

I turned sharply and stormed out of the room, my whole body trembling. My heart pounded so hard it felt like it would burst out of my chest. Tears burned in my eyes, but I refused to let them fall. Not now. Not because of him.

I pushed open my bedroom door, slammed it shut, and collapsed onto the bed. The moment my head hit the pillow, the tears came. Hot, angry, endless.

A soft knock echoed in the room. My breath hitched. I wiped my face quickly. "Come in."

Vincent stepped inside, his face unreadable. "Are you okay, Scarlett?"

"I’m fine," I said quickly, sitting up.

He didn’t seem convinced, but he didn’t push. Instead, he walked over, sliding into the bed beside me. He reached out, brushing a strand of hair from my face. "I missed you."

My stomach twisted. Guilt clawed at me, but I forced a smile. "I was just tired."

He leaned in, his lips grazing my cheek. "Can we…?"

My throat tightened. I turned my face away. "I—I can’t. Not tonight. I’m sorry."

He sighed, rolling onto his back. "Alright. I’ll wait."

I squeezed my eyes shut. I didn’t deserve his patience.

But that night, something jolted me awake. A strange feeling—like I wasn’t alone. My eyes fluttered open, and my breath caught in my throat.

Vincent was hovering over me, his hands gripping the hem of my nightgown.

"Vincent, what the hell are you doing?" My voice was sharp, but my limbs felt frozen.

He didn’t answer. His hands were already moving lower.

Panic shot through me like lightning. I grabbed his wrist, yanking it away. "Get off me!"

His eyes flickered, something dark lurking beneath them. "You’re my wife, Scarlett."

"That doesn’t give you the right to touch me without my consent!"

He pressed forward, his weight pinning me down. My pulse pounded, my breath coming in sharp gasps. Fear wrapped around my throat, squeezing tight.

No.

I wouldn’t let this happen.

With every ounce of strength I had, I shoved him off me. He stumbled back, shock flashing across his face.

"Don’t you ever try that again," I hissed, my entire body trembling. "Or I swear to God, I’ll make you regret it."

He stared at me for a long moment, his expression unreadable. Then, without another word, he turned and walked out of the room.

I stayed there, chest heaving, fingers clenched so tight they ached.

I only married him because of this father but getting married to him was what I wanted. I don't dislike him but I can't and don't have sex with him now. As I haven't yet gotten over his Dad.

Why the heck did I accept this marriage in the first place? Now I'm running crazy everyday. I can't concentrate with his dad in the same house. This is bad! 

“Welcome Mom.” I heard Vincent's voice from downstairs and my heart almost dropped.

Vincent's mom was here. The first love whom Zayden always talks about with my Dad.

That's impossible!

My chances of having him now are slim. I rushed to the door watching, she was still locked, beautiful and young.
